Understanding LED Technology
What Makes LEDs Different?
Light Emitting Diodes (LEDs) have revolutionized the lighting industry due to their energy efficiency and longevity. Unlike traditional incandescent or halogen bulbs, LEDs convert a higher percentage of energy into light rather than heat. This efficiency not only reduces energy costs but also extends the lifespan of the bulbs significantly, often lasting up to 25 times longer than their incandescent counterparts. The technology behind LEDs involves the movement of electrons through a semiconductor material, which emits light when energized. This fundamental difference in how light is produced is what sets LEDs apart from other lighting technologies.
Moreover, LEDs are highly versatile. They come in various shapes, sizes, and color temperatures, making them suitable for a wide range of applications. For outdoor flood lighting, the ability to produce bright, focused light while consuming less power is particularly advantageous. This technology allows contractors to meet both aesthetic and functional requirements in outdoor spaces. Additionally, the compact size of LEDs enables innovative designs, allowing for creative lighting solutions that can enhance architectural features or landscape elements without overwhelming the environment.
Benefits of Using LED Flood Lights
When it comes to outdoor flood lighting, the benefits of LED technology are manifold. First and foremost, energy efficiency is a key selling point. By switching to LED flood lights, contractors can help their clients reduce energy consumption significantly, which is especially important for large outdoor areas that require continuous lighting. Furthermore, many LED flood lights are equipped with smart technology, allowing for programmable settings and remote control, which can further optimize energy use and enhance convenience.
In addition to energy savings, LED flood lights are known for their durability. They are typically made from robust materials that can withstand harsh weather conditions, making them ideal for outdoor installations. This durability translates to lower maintenance costs for clients, as fewer replacements are needed over time. Additionally, LED flood lights are resistant to shock and vibration, which makes them a safer choice for dynamic environments. Their ability to perform well in extreme temperatures, from freezing cold to sweltering heat, ensures reliable operation year-round, providing peace of mind for both contractors and end-users alike.
Installation Considerations
Choosing the Right LED Flood Light
Selecting the appropriate LED flood light is crucial for achieving the desired lighting effect. Factors such as lumen output, beam angle, and color temperature should be carefully considered. Lumen output indicates the brightness of the light, while the beam angle affects how the light is distributed across the area. A wider beam angle is suitable for illuminating larger spaces, while a narrower beam can provide focused lighting for specific areas.
Color temperature is another important aspect. Measured in Kelvin (K), it defines the color appearance of the light. For outdoor applications, a color temperature between 3000K and 5000K is often recommended, as it provides a warm to cool white light that enhances visibility and aesthetics. Furthermore, understanding the specific environment where the flood lights will be installed can guide your choice. For instance, coastal areas may benefit from fixtures that are corrosion-resistant, while urban settings might require lights with higher lumen outputs to counteract ambient light pollution.
Proper Installation Techniques
Proper installation of LED flood lights is essential to maximize their performance and lifespan. Contractors should ensure that the fixtures are securely mounted and positioned at the correct angles to avoid light pollution and glare. It’s also important to consider the electrical requirements, as LED lights may require specific voltage levels and wiring configurations. Additionally, attention should be paid to the height at which the lights are installed; higher placements can reduce shadows and enhance the overall coverage of the area.
Additionally, utilizing smart controls can enhance the functionality of outdoor flood lighting. Dimmers, timers, and motion sensors can be integrated to provide flexibility and efficiency, allowing clients to customize their lighting based on their needs. Beyond these features, incorporating smart technology can also lead to energy savings, as lights can be programmed to turn off during daylight hours or when no motion is detected. This not only conserves energy but also extends the lifespan of the fixtures, making it a wise investment for both residential and commercial properties.
Market Trends and Innovations
Smart Lighting Solutions
The trend towards smart lighting solutions is gaining momentum in the outdoor lighting market. Many LED flood lights now come equipped with smart technology that allows for remote control and automation. This innovation not only enhances user convenience but also contributes to energy savings by allowing users to adjust lighting based on real-time needs.
Smart flood lights can be controlled via smartphone apps or integrated with home automation systems, enabling features such as scheduling, dimming, and even color changing. This level of control is particularly appealing to homeowners looking to enhance security and ambiance in their outdoor spaces. Additionally, some advanced models incorporate motion sensors and adaptive lighting, which automatically adjust brightness levels based on the time of day or the presence of people, providing both safety and energy efficiency.
Moreover, the integration of smart lighting with voice-activated assistants is becoming increasingly popular, allowing users to manage their outdoor lighting through simple voice commands. This hands-free approach not only adds a layer of convenience but also makes it easier for individuals with mobility challenges to control their environment. As technology continues to evolve, we can expect to see even more innovative features in smart lighting solutions, such as integration with weather forecasts to adjust lighting based on conditions like rain or fog.
Environmental Considerations
As sustainability becomes increasingly important, lighting contractors are encouraged to consider the environmental impact of their installations. LED flood lights are inherently more eco-friendly compared to traditional lighting options, but contractors can take additional steps to ensure their projects align with green building practices.
Using fixtures made from recyclable materials, incorporating solar-powered options, and promoting energy-efficient designs are ways to enhance the sustainability of outdoor lighting projects. Clients are becoming more environmentally conscious, and offering green solutions can set contractors apart in a competitive market. Furthermore, the adoption of smart technology in lighting systems can contribute to a reduction in light pollution, as these systems can be programmed to minimize unnecessary illumination during certain hours, thereby preserving the natural night sky.
In addition to these practices, contractors can also educate their clients on the benefits of energy-efficient lighting, such as lower utility bills and reduced carbon footprints. By providing comprehensive information on the lifecycle of lighting products and their environmental impacts, contractors can foster a deeper understanding of sustainability among homeowners. This not only enhances client relationships but also positions contractors as leaders in the movement towards greener construction practices, ultimately benefiting both the environment and their business reputation.
Challenges in the LED Flood Light Market
Initial Costs vs. Long-Term Savings
While the initial investment in LED flood lights may be higher than traditional options, the long-term savings associated with energy efficiency and reduced maintenance costs often outweigh this upfront expense. Educating clients about the total cost of ownership can help alleviate concerns about initial costs.
Contractors should provide clear comparisons that illustrate how LED flood lights can lead to significant savings over time. This information can be pivotal in convincing clients to make the switch to LED technology.
Quality and Performance Variability
Not all LED flood lights are created equal. The market is flooded with various brands and products, leading to variability in quality and performance. Contractors must be diligent in selecting high-quality products from reputable manufacturers to ensure reliability and customer satisfaction.
Testing and researching products before recommending them to clients can help mitigate the risks associated with poor-quality LEDs. Look for certifications such as Energy Star or UL listing, which can serve as indicators of quality and performance.
Future of Outdoor LED Flood Lighting
Advancements in LED Technology
The future of outdoor LED flood lighting looks promising, with ongoing advancements in technology. Innovations such as tunable white LEDs, which allow users to adjust the color temperature based on their preferences, are becoming more prevalent. This flexibility can enhance the user experience and make outdoor spaces more inviting.
Furthermore, advancements in energy storage and solar technology are expected to play a significant role in the evolution of outdoor lighting solutions. As battery technology improves, the feasibility of solar-powered LED flood lights will increase, offering even more sustainable options for contractors and clients alike.
Integration with Renewable Energy Sources
As the push for renewable energy continues, integrating LED flood lighting with solar panels and other renewable sources will become more common. This integration can provide clients with a completely off-grid solution, reducing their reliance on traditional power sources and lowering their carbon footprint.
Contractors who stay ahead of these trends and educate themselves on renewable energy options will be well-positioned to meet the evolving needs of their clients. Offering comprehensive solutions that include both lighting and energy generation can enhance a contractor’s value proposition in the marketplace.
